Requirements

  • Experience in Broadcast/Graphic Design, Visual Arts, or a related field
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ite (specifically, Photoshop, Illustrator)
  • Strong understanding of design principles, typography, color theory, and asset management
  • Knowledge of video production, animation principles, and techniques (preferred)
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ment
  • Excellent communication skills and attention to detail
  • A portfolio showcasing a variety of design projects, including digital, print, broadcast, and media
  • Passion for sports, with an interest in the sports media industry (plus)
  • Available to work varied hours and weekends
  • High School Diploma or Equivalent (required); Bachelor’s degree or equivalent (preferred)
  • Knowledge of animation and 3D concepts, tools, and techniques (preferred)

Responsibilities

  • Use Adobe software to create designs and animations for ESPN productions adhering to workflow processes
  • Collaborate with senior designers and other team members to develop creative concepts and execute design projects
  • Work independently and with Show Unit personnel to deliver on-time, on-brand graphic content for live production requests, for on-air linear broadcasts, streaming productions, and digital platforms
  • Learn and maintain systems for organizing and managing design assets, including templates, style guides, and libraries
  • Assist in the design and production of on-air and studio display graphics, informational graphics, logo design, and animations
  • Produce and manage identity graphics (player, entity, and brand imagery) and other library content assets
  • Support the creation of on-air graphics and animations for live sports broadcasts and highlight packages
  • Ensure all designs adhere to brand guidelines and maintain consistency across all platforms
  • Stay up to date with industry trends and incorporate new design techniques to keep content fresh and innovative
  • Receive and implement feedback from senior designers and art directors to refine design work
  • Maintain high standards of efficiency, consistency, accuracy, creativity, and timely delivery of all requests
